@charset "utf-8";
.crm_content_acc_year_box{position:relative;height:100%;padding: 80px 0 0;}
.crm_acc_year_tab_box{position:absolute;top: -4px;left:0;width:100%;background:#484848}

.crm_acc_year_content_box{position: relative;height: 100%;}

.crm_acc_year_tab{float:left;width: 322px;height:34px;padding:10px;text-align:center;background:#484848;color:#fff;border-left: 1px #bbb solid;border-right: 1px #bbb solid;margin: 0 -1px;}
.crm_acc_year_tab:hover{background:#4a0d24}

.sky1 .sky1t,
.sky2 .sky2t,
.you1 .you1t,
.sky_to_you .sky_to_you,
.you_to_chmos .you_to_chmos{background:#950038}

.crm_acc_year_content{position:relative;height:100%;padding:35px 0 78px}

.crm_acc_year_title_box{position:absolute;top: -43px;left:0;width:970px}
.crm_acc_year_title_date,
.crm_acc_year_title_history{float:left;width:136px;height:34px;padding:10px;background:#2e2e2e;color:#fff;margin:0 1px 0 0;position:relative}

.crm_acc_year_title_date{position:relative;width: 960px;padding: 0;text-align:center}
.crm_acc_year_title_history{width: 217px;text-overflow: ellipsis;white-space: nowrap;overflow: hidden;text-align: right;}

.crm_acc_year_list_date,
.crm_acc_year_list_history{float:left;width:136px;height:34px;padding:10px;background:#2e2e2e;color:#fff;margin:0 1px 0 0;position:relative}
.crm_acc_year_list_date{width: 88px;text-align:center}
.crm_acc_year_list_history{width: 290px;text-overflow: ellipsis;white-space: nowrap;overflow: hidden;text-align: right;}



.crm_acc_year_scroll_box{overflow-y:scroll;width:970px;height:100%;margin:0 -5px 0 0}
.crm_acc_year_scroll_box:-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,.3);background:rgba(106,255,241,0.7);border:1px rgba(255,255,255,0.17) solid}
.crm_acc_year_scroll_box::-webkit-scrollbar{width:5px;background:#ababab}
.crm_acc_year_scroll_box::-webkit-scrollbar-thumb{-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,.3);background:#e91e63;border:1px rgba(255,255,255,0.17) solid}
.crm_acc_year_list_box{position:relative;opacity:0.9;margin:1px 0}
.crm_acc_year_list_box:nth-child(even){opacity:0.9}
.crm_acc_year_list_box:hover{opacity:1}

.plus_minus_acc_year{position: absolute;bottom: 0;left: 0;}

.plus_minus_acc_year .plus_title,
.plus_minus_acc_year .minus_title,
.plus_minus_acc_year .plus_minus_title_y{width: 316px;}

.color1{background: #0d414c;}
.color2{background: #521111;}
.color3{background: #210f4e;}

.acc1{width: 230px;}
.acc2{width: 150px;background: #88002e !important;}
.acc3{width: 200px;background: #004488 !important;}
.acc4{width: 238px;background: #300084 !important;}
.acc7{width: 92px;background: #321e00 !important;}

.left1{float:left}
.left2{float:left;margin: 0 0 0 10px;}
.left3{clear:both;float:left}

#ymd_yy{float:left;width: 108px;height:34px;background: #d53300;text-align:center;color: #fff;}
.mm_list{float:left;width:70px;height:34px;padding:10px 0;text-align:center;cursor: pointer;background: #24333a;margin: 0 0 0 1px;color: #fff;}
.mmo{background: #d53300;}